How much do process improvement project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 22, 2026, the average yearly pay for process improvement project manager in Vermont is $109,439.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$87,200.00 and $129,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Process Improvement Project Manager vs Business Analyst?

AspectProcess Improvement Project ManagerBusiness Analyst
CertificationsLean, Six Sigma, PMPCBAP, PMI-PBA
Work EnvironmentProject teams, cross-functional departmentsBusiness units, IT, consulting
Industry UsageManufacturing, healthcare, financeIT, finance, consulting
Primary FocusStreamlining processes, project executionAnalyzing business needs, requirements gathering

The Process Improvement Project Manager focuses on leading projects to optimize processes using methodologies like Lean and Six Sigma, often managing teams and timelines. In contrast, a Business Analyst concentrates on understanding business needs, gathering requirements, and recommending solutions. While both roles require analytical skills and industry certifications, their core responsibilities differ in scope and focus.

What does a Process Improvement Project Manager do?

A Process Improvement Project Manager is responsible for analyzing existing business processes and identifying areas where efficiency, quality, or productivity can be enhanced. They lead projects aimed at streamlining workflows, reducing costs, and improving overall organizational performance. This role involves collaborating with cross-functional teams, using methodologies like Lean or Six Sigma, and implementing changes to achieve measurable improvements. They also monitor the results of implemented solutions to ensure lasting positive impact.

How does a Process Improvement Project Manager typically collaborate with cross-functional teams to drive change?

Process Improvement Project Managers work closely with stakeholders across various departments, such as operations, IT, and quality assurance, to identify inefficiencies and implement solutions. They often lead regular meetings, facilitate workshops, and use data-driven approaches to ensure all team members are aligned with project goals. Effective communication and relationship-building are crucial, as these managers must encourage buy-in, address concerns, and foster a culture of continuous improvement throughout the organization.
